Option 1: Streaming the Dream (the legal way, that is)
- Now TV: Calling all tech-savvy folks! Now TV offers Chicago Fire as part of their entertainment membership. Just like magic, you'll have access to instant streaming, so you can binge-watch those daring rescues faster than you can say "Shamrock Shake."
- Sky Go/Sky Store: If you're already a Sky subscriber, then you're in luck! Fire up Sky Go for live streaming or head over to the Sky Store to purchase individual episodes or seasons. Just remember, unlike a real fire, this one might cost you a few quid.
Pro Tip: Be sure to check for any free trials these platforms might offer. A little trial run never hurt anyone (except maybe those pesky fictional flames).
Option 2: Calling on the Big Guns (Amazon Prime Video)
- For those of you who already have an Amazon Prime subscription, rejoice! Chicago Fire is available for streaming on Prime Video. Just be prepared to navigate the occasional "lads, fancy a pint?" commercial in between saving lives.
